They all seemed genuinely happy to be there, even if they were going back to work after the event. They talked about specific cases/deals they were working on, they lavished praise on the training they get from partners who are at the top of their fields, etc. I got a really good vibe from them.
The ones who said they were going back to work said that they have busy days and not so busy days but the schedule isn't quite as bad as people generally make it out to be. One said that she had an easy day but the in-house counsel at a client sent over a bunch of work at 5pm that slammed her and will make for a long night. That seems to be fairly common.
They value facetime at the firm and associate offices are sprinkled in with partners and senior associates, so it's important to be there but it's not absolutely necessary that you're the first in and last out: one first year said that sometimes to beat rush hour, he'll work from home in the morning and come in around 10 or he'll leave at 4 and work from home for a few hours in the evening. The firm is learning that technology pretty much makes people available.

I have absolutely no ties to this firm or Chicago, but wanted to at least shed some light on these "receptions" that firms host. First, the attendees from the firm are typically VERY CAREFULLY selected. Firms don't allow just any old associate to walk in and start sharing experiences. Rather, the recruiting department has selected the most social and typically up-beat associates. These are the partners/associates that go to all receptions and recruiting events.
It is great that everyone was pleasant, and perhaps everyone is actually pleasant at this firm, but as a current associate at a NY biglaw firm, I would caution anyone from taking away too much about firm culture/associate satisfaction from these receptions.

Yeah. My advice for any reception is to take it for what it's worth...not much. I had a classmate who left a similar reception at Jenner beaming and touting it as the best firm in the city. She interviewed there and absolutely hated it and turned down an offer.
As mentioned, of course they will tell you they are busy (but not too busy). Of course they will seem optimistic about the firm--surely Jenner is not suffering. However, I think it's rare to go to a reception and not enjoy it. Whether it's the view from the reception room, the attractive, well-balanced associates they parade in front of you, the food, or whatever, firms are always going to try to impress. The best thing to do is to talk to classmates, friends, alumni, etc that work there that will be honest with you.
